stopVideo method

  1. @override
Future<void> stopVideo()

Stops and cancels loading of the current video. This function should be reserved for rare situations when you know that the user will not be watching additional video in the player. If your intent is to pause the video, you should just call the pauseVideo function. If you want to change the video that the player is playing, you can call one of the queueing functions without calling stopVideo first.

Unlike the pauseVideo function, which leaves the player in the paused (2) state, the stopVideo function could put the player into any not-playing state, including ended (0), paused (2), video cued (5) or unstarted (-1).

Implementation

@override
Future<void> stopVideo() {
  return _run('stopVideo');
}
